From ea3716e26de21eaec478683384235e1e052ab194 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Luke Lau Date: Thu, 29 May 2025 14:15:05 +0100 Subject: [PATCH 1/3] [RISCV] Fix coalescing vsetvlis when AVL and vl register are the same With EVL tail folding we can end up with vsetvlis where the output vl and the input AVL are the same register. When we try to coalesce it we crashed because we tried to move the def's live interval before the kill's live interval, e.g. in this example: (vn0 def) dead $x0 = PseudoVSETIVLI 1, 192, implicit-def $vl, implicit-def $vtype renamable $v9 = COPY killed renamable $v8 (vn1 def) %23:gprnox0 = PseudoVSETVLI killed (vn0) %23:gprnox0, 197, implicit-def $vl, implicit-def $vtype We would try to move the vn1 def VNInfo up to the previous VSETVLI, in the middle of vn0's segment. However separately, we were also assuming that the vl would only have one definition and thus were just taking the VNInfo from beginIndex(), so we ended up with a backwards segment and got the error "Cannot create empty or backwards segment". This fixes these two issues, the first one by moving the AVL operand + live interval up first, and the second by taking the VNInfo from NextMI's slot index.
